Output f75c8d91cd385d34b4a88a896ac84036da82f5fa97a443c0d4f9591c8cb48498:0

value
25860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80682946f5fe6c1421a8c0cf757fe5baf36576a9 OP_EQUAL
address
3DPyCM8J5osFb4LpAjtg3qd6UTm53amqwF
transaction
f75c8d91cd385d34b4a88a896ac84036da82f5fa97a443c0d4f9591c8cb48498
spent
true